To Add or Not To Add

Updated: May 1, 2021

It's almost time for the 147th Run for the Roses. By now, I'm sure you've read a ton of analyses & watched a bunch of preview shows. So what's left? Oh right - eventually you'll have to place a bet or two (or 17) & the question we'll all have to answer for our exotic bets is "How many friggin' horses do I include?" or to paraphrase Billy Shakes (that's what his friends called him) - "To Add or Not To Add". Well maybe we can help you answer that question by giving our recommendations for each of the 20 horses hoping to be the first to cross the finish line on May 1st.

🏇🏾# 1 Known Agenda

M/L: 6-1

Trainer: Todd Pletcher/Jockey: Irad Ortiz Jr.


Add (Our Lundin Line's #3 Pick)

- Todd Pletcher is Winning at 31 % over the last 30 days (72 starts), with a +85% ROI & ITM at 67%

- Irad Ortiz Jr. may be the hottest jockey in the country right now. Over the last 10 days, he's Winning @ 31% & ITM @ 71%.

- #1 Post Position shouldn't be a problem due to 1) new starting gate that puts the #1 position in what would have been around # or #3. 2) not a lot of speed to his outside until #3 Medina Spirit & 3) Presser running style out of the 1st position bodes well for the the 1 1/4 distance of the Derby.

🏇🏾# 14 Essential Quality

M/L: 2-1

Trainer: Brad Cox/Jockey: Luis Saez


Add (our Lundin Line's #1 pick)

- Only 1 of 5 horses to have a career Beyer Speed of at least 95 & BRIS of at least 100

- 5-0 record (4 Stakes).

- Strong last Race beating Highly Motivated in the Blue Grass.

- Meets the 3 requirements for the majority of Derby winners since 2013 (with the exceptions of last year's Sept. running, the DQ of Maximum Security & Orby's Win in 2013) Those are: Won a 100 pt. Derby Prep Race, Undefeated as a 3 yr. old & races at or near the front.

- Over the past 30 days (109 starts), Saez is Winning at 28%

 

🏇🏾# 15 Rock Your World

M/L: 5-1

Trainer: John Sadler/Jockey: Joel Rosario


Add

- First dirt race was an extremely impressive wire-to-wire Win in the Santa Anita Derby where he beat Medina Spirit by 4 lengths

- Like Essential Quality - he also meets the 3 requirements for the majority of Derby winners since 2013 - those are: Won a 100 pt. Derby Prep Race, Undefeated as a 3 yr. old & races at or near the front. (see note on Essential Quality for exceptions)

- Undefeated with his highest Equibase Speed Rating of 103 earned in the SA Derby (also the only horse to earn a triple digit Beyer for last race within the field)

- Rosario is Winning at 39% over the last 10 days (31 starts)
